summaryrefslogtreecommitdiff
path: root/emu/port/dis.c
diff options
context:
space:
mode:
authorforsyth <forsyth@vitanuova.com>2011-02-24 23:08:03 +0000
committerforsyth <forsyth@vitanuova.com>2011-02-24 23:08:03 +0000
commitcb6deecc455ddb2a6a83cedaafc576838587d217 (patch)
treeb1ef6ea611515c18da988ee2a368939d2eb8f1be /emu/port/dis.c
parent39f1a17d6a1f530b723b42717a2c14db6a25cf16 (diff)
20110224-2305
Diffstat (limited to 'emu/port/dis.c')
-rw-r--r--emu/port/dis.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/emu/port/dis.c b/emu/port/dis.c
index 881bd81f..8c474ff6 100644
--- a/emu/port/dis.c
+++ b/emu/port/dis.c
@@ -459,6 +459,8 @@ newgrp(Prog *p)
p->flags &= ~(Ppropagate|Pnotifyleader);
g->id = p->pid;
g->flags = 0;
+ if(p->group != nil)
+ g->flags |= p->group->flags&Pprivatemem;
g->child = nil;
pg = delgrp(p);
g->head = g->tail = p;